Analysis

Guyana recorded 0 kt per square kilometre for enteric fermentation — emissions (ch4), per square kilometre in 2023.

The figure is down 0.5% on the previous year and down 13.3% over ten years.

Over the whole period, enteric fermentation — emissions (ch4), per square kilometre in Guyana peaked at 0.0001 kt per square kilometre in 1966 and was at its lowest, 0 kt per square kilometre, in 2020.

Guyana ranks 163rd of 170 countries on this measure, in the bottom quarter.

The long-run direction has been consistently falling across the 63 years of available data.

How this figure is calculated

Enteric Fermentation — Emissions (CH4) div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.

Enteric Fermentation — Emissions (CH4) ÷ Land area (sq. km)
